Transaction 5b6328d81df901d5334c2d3c1e5e44f345349417be843326afeae92392ca5975

2 Input
2 Outputs
  • 5b6328d81df901d5334c2d3c1e5e44f345349417be843326afeae92392ca5975:0
  • value  96600000
    address  174sjZE7eFuUvLm28nHjv63xZkfW4Us2AL
  • 5b6328d81df901d5334c2d3c1e5e44f345349417be843326afeae92392ca5975:1
  • value  1973948
    address  1JcEfArjknyffN8uVK6XQxF9GJreZqf3mr